About Gayatri Saraf

Gayatri Saraf is a scholar working on Psychiatry and Mental health, Biological Psychiatry and Clinical Psychology, having authored 26 papers that have together received 388 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Bipolar Disorder and Treatment (17 papers), Electroconvulsive Therapy Studies (10 papers), Schizophrenia research and treatment (5 papers), Maternal Mental Health During Pregnancy and Postpartum (4 papers), Electrolyte and hormonal disorders (3 papers), Coordination Chemistry and Organometallics (3 papers), Obsessive-Compulsive Spectrum Disorders (2 papers) and Mental Health Treatment and Access (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Psychiatry and Mental health (201 citations), Biological Psychiatry (33 citations) and Clinical Psychology (112 citations). Gayatri Saraf has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, India and Brazil. Frequent co-authors include Lakshmi N. Yatham, Kamyar Keramatian, Trisha Chakrabarty, Jairo Vinícius Pinto, Geetha Desai, Harish Thippeswamy, Santosh K. Chaturvedi, Carmen G. Loiselle, Fay J. Strohschein and Raymond W. Lam. Their work appears in journals such as Bipolar Disorders, The Canadian Journal of Psychiatry, Journal of Affective Disorders, Asian Journal of Psychiatry and JAMA Network Open.
